Google releases Gemini 3.8 Flash, its third model in six weeks

5 sources
  • Google released Gemini 3.8 Flash on Wednesday, its third Flash model in six weeks, claiming it rivals costlier frontier models in coding and reasoning tasks.
  • The company also launched the Fairwind Program, giving over 650 government and enterprise partners access to a cybersecurity-tuned variant and automated patching tools.
  • The release comes as Anthropic and OpenAI debuted competing cybersecurity AI models the same day, intensifying the race to secure critical infrastructure.
